Under-$100 Nordstrom Basics That Satisfy Your Spring Shopping Itch

[]

My classic style relies on the basics—like perfect-fitting jeans and wear-everywhere button-downs. They make getting dressed easier, and everything pairs well together.

Shopping has been on my mind as we head into the new spring season, and my closet could use an upgrade since I’ve worn the same few pieces for months—it’s that time of year when my favorite white T-shirts look dingy, and my cashmere knits feel worse for wear. I like to invest in staples, but I try to do so on a budget when my wardrobe needs refreshing. I turn to Nordstrom when in doubt because I can effectively replace my most worn items for $100 or less.

I’m hunting for chic pieces to wear to the office and to cure my hankering for newness, so I rounded up a complete spring capsule wardrobe from Nordstrom that you can buy now and wear forever.

Ahead, shop for all my favorite affordable wardrobe finds on Nordstrom’s site. While timeless pieces comprise a large portion of the list, it also includes new spring trends, like dark-wash denim and nautical-inspired cardigans.

Mango Lulu Vest

This vest from Mango is an easy elevated swap for your usual tank.

Gender Inclusive Samba Sneaker

Adidas Gender Inclusive Samba Sneakers

Yes, these shoes hit right at the top of the budget I set for myself, but they’re a classic you can’t go wrong with.

Short Sleeve Cardigan

Topshop Short Sleeve Cardigan

Transition out of your heavy knits with this short-sleeved cardigan.

Mixed Stripe Oversize Cotton Poplin Button-Up Shirt

Madewell Mixed Stripe Oversize Cotton Poplin Button-Up Shirt

Or, swap your usual plain button-down shirt for this striped version. It would look so cute styled underneath a gray pullover sweater.

The Icon Hourglass Blazer

Open Edit The Icon Hourglass Blazer

Upgrade your blazer selection with this slightly formal fitted pick.

Saskia Pocket Shoulder Bag

Topshop Saskia Pocket Shoulder Bag

Katy Perry The Evie Snakeskin Embossed Slingback Flats

Katy Perry The Evie Snakeskin Embossed Slingback Flats

I love these croc-printed slingback flats in a bold red hue.

Wide Leg Pull-On Linen Blend Pants

Caslon Wide Leg Pull-On Linen Blend Pants

It’s almost linen pants season. These tend to sell out quickly, so pick them up now before they’re gone.

Open Top Canvas Tote Bag

Lands’ End Open Top Canvas Tote Bag

Canvas totes make the best summer work bags that can easily be carried on the weekend.

Phoenix Belt

Petit Moments Phoenix Belt

Upgrade your jeans-and-tees with this western-inspired belt.

Perfect Crewneck T-Shirt

NIC+ZOE Perfect Crewneck T-Shirt

This is one of the best T-shirts I own, so I’m buying another one ahead of the warm weather season.

Rhianon Wedge Slingback Leather Pump

Nordstrom Rhianon Wedge Slingback Leather Pumps

Small Staple Hoop Earrings

Jenny Bird Small Staple Hoop Earrings

I’ve been trying to up my accessories game, and I’ve been relying on this pair of hoops from Jenny Bird in the process.

Lindy Ruched Crop Top

Reformation Lindy Ruched Crop Top

This isn’t your average tank top with the wrapped detail that adds shape.

Ribcage High Waist Wide Leg Jeans

Levi’s Ribcage High Waist Wide Leg Jeans

Dark washes like this are trending for spring 2025, and this high-waisted fit is second-to-none.

Princess Polly Nellie Minidress

Princess Polly Nellie Minidress

Open Edit Rib Cardigan

This cardigan comes in a few colors, but I would style this black version over a white tee.

Catriona Stripe Cotton Blend Cardigan

Boden Catriona Stripe Cotton Blend Cardigan

I’m tapping into the nautical fashion trend with this stripey sweater from Boden.

Dreaming Mary Jane Flat

Steve Madden Dreaming Mary Jane Flats

My favorite ballet flats look worse for wear, so I’m shopping for this pair for spring.

Madewell Oversize Poplin Button-Up Shirt

Madewell Oversize Poplin Button-Up Shirt

I rely on oversized button downs, and this one is a personal favorite.

We the Free Opal Swing Denim Trucker Jacket

Free People We the Free Opal Swing Denim Trucker Jacket

It’s almost time to put away my puffer and swap them for lighter weight coats, like this denim jacket.

Fame Pleated Midi Skirt

Lioness Fame Pleated Midi Skirt

The subtle belted detail on this midi skirt from Lioness adds a slight edge to an otherwise classic silhouette.

Nordstrom Short Sleeve Cashmere Sweater

Nordstrom Short Sleeve Cashmere Sweater

Nordstrom’s cashmere range is full of editor-favorite options, and this sweater tee is a perfect example of why it has such a fashion caché.

{ window.reliablePageLoad.then(() => { var componentContainer = document.querySelector(“#slice-container-newsletterForm-articleInbodyContent-E4KD9ne4DPbz7Nn3f9n6FT”); if (componentContainer) { var data = {“layout”:”inbodyContent”,”header”:”Stay In The Know”,”tagline”:”Get exclusive access to fashion and beauty trends, hot-off-the-press celebrity news, and more.”,”formFooterText”:”By submitting your information you agree to the Terms & Conditions and Privacy Policy and are aged 16 or over.”,”successMessage”:{“body”:”Thank you for signing up. You will receive a confirmation email shortly.”},”failureMessage”:”There was a problem. Please refresh the page and try again.”,”method”:”POST”,”inputs”:[{“type”:”hidden”,”name”:”NAME”},{“type”:”email”,”name”:”MAIL”,”placeholder”:”Your Email Address”,”required”:true},{“type”:”hidden”,”name”:”NEWSLETTER_CODE”,”value”:”ZMC-D”},{“type”:”hidden”,”name”:”LANG”,”value”:”EN”},{“type”:”hidden”,”name”:”SOURCE”,”value”:”60″},{“type”:”hidden”,”name”:”COUNTRY”},{“type”:”checkbox”,”name”:”CONTACT_OTHER_BRANDS”,”label”:{“text”:”Contact me with news and offers from other Future brands”}},{“type”:”checkbox”,”name”:”CONTACT_PARTNERS”,”label”:{“text”:”Receive email from us on behalf of our trusted partners or sponsors”}},{“type”:”submit”,”value”:”Sign me up”,”required”:true}],”endpoint”:”https://newsletter-subscribe.futureplc.com/v2/submission/submit”,”analytics”:[{“analyticsType”:”widgetViewed”}],”ariaLabels”:{}}; var newsletterForm;(()=>{“use strict”;var e={973:(e,t,n)=>{function o(e,t){(null==t||t>e.length)&&(t=e.length);for(var n=0,o=new Array(t);nO});var a=n(651),l=n.n(a);function i(e,t,n){return t in e?Object.defineProperty(e,t,{value:n,enumerable:!0,configurable:!0,writable:!0}):e[t]=n,e}var c=function(e){if(“undefined”!=typeof document){var t=document.cookie.match(“(^|;) ?”.concat(e,”=([^;]*)(;|$)”));return t?t[2]:null}return null};function u(e,t){var n=Object.keys(e);if(Object.getOwnPropertySymbols){var o=Object.getOwnPropertySymbols(e);t&&(o=o.filter((function(t){return Object.getOwnPropertyDescriptor(e,t).enumerable}))),n.push.apply(n,o)}return n}function s(e){for(var t=1;t-1&&”email”===(null==E?void 0:E.toLowerCase())&&_(“text”),”hidden”===(null==u?void 0:u.toLowerCase())&&t&&(w((function(e){return s(s({},e),{},i({},t,n))})),”COUNTRY”===(null==t?void 0:t.toUpperCase()))){var e=c(“FTR_Country_Code”)||c(“FTR_User_Defined_Country_Code”)||void 0;w((function(n){return s(s({},n),{},i({},t,e))}))}}),[]);var g=l().createElement(“input”,{“data-hydrate”:!0,type:E,className:”form__”.concat(u,”-input “).concat(y),value:n,name:t,required:f,disabled:p,placeholder:d,autoFocus:h,onChange:function(e){if(“submit”!==u){var t=e.target,n=t.name,o=t.value,r=t.checked;w((function(e){return s(s({},e),{},i({},n,”checkbox”===u?r:o))}))}}});return o?l().createElement(“label”,{className:”form__”.concat(u,”-label”)},g,o.text):l().createElement(l().Fragment,null,g)};var m=function(e){var t=e.layout,n=e.method,o=e.action,i=e.handleSubmit,c=e.inputs,u=r((0,a.useState)({}),2),s=u[0],m=u[1];return l().createElement(“form”,{“data-hydrate”:!0,className:”newsletter-form__form newsletter-form__form–“.concat(t),method:n,action:o,onSubmit:function(e){return i(e,s)}},null==c?void 0:c.map((function(e){return l().createElement(d,{key:””.concat(e.name,”-“).concat(e.value),setFormValues:m,autofocus:”exitIntent”===t&&”email”===e.type||void 0,type:e.type,label:e.label,value:e.value,name:e.name,placeholder:e.placeholder,required:e.required,inputClassName:”form_input form__”.concat(e.type,”-input form__”).concat(e.type,”-input–“).concat(t)})})))};const f=function(e,t){setTimeout((function(){window.freyr.cmd.push((function(){window.freyr.pushAndUpdate(e,t)}))}),0)};var v=function(e){var t,n,o,r,a,l,i,c,u,s,d={submission:{name:null!==(t=null==e?void 0:e.NAME)&&void 0!==t?t:””,email:null!==(n=null==e?void 0:e.MAIL)&&void 0!==n?n:””,code:null!==(o=null==e?void 0:e.NEWSLETTER_CODE)&&void 0!==o?o:””,source:null!==(r=null==e?void 0:e.SOURCE)&&void 0!==r?r:0,language:null!==(a=null==e?void 0:e.LANG)&&void 0!==a?a:””,country:null!==(l=null==e?void 0:e.COUNTRY)&&void 0!==l?l:””,consent:{marketing:null!==(i=null!==(c=Boolean(null==e?void 0:e.CONTACT_OTHER_BRANDS))&&void 0!==c?c:Boolean(null==e?void 0:e.CONTACT_OTHER_BRANDS_AND_PARTNERS))&&void 0!==i&&i,data:null!==(u=null!==(s=Boolean(null==e?void 0:e.CONTACT_PARTNERS))&&void 0!==s?s:Boolean(null==e?void 0:e.CONTACT_OTHER_BRANDS_AND_PARTNERS))&&void 0!==u&&u}}};return JSON.stringify(d)},p=function(e){var t=e.layout,n=e.source;return”exitIntent”===t?”SIGNUP – Exit Intent – “.concat(n):”Newsletter signup – “.concat(n)};function y(e){for(var t=[],n=1;n{var o=n(81);t.createRoot=o.createRoot,t.hydrateRoot=o.hydrateRoot},651:e=>{e.exports=window.slice.React},81:e=>{e.exports=window.slice.ReactDOM}},t={};function n(o){var r=t[o];if(void 0!==r)return r.exports;var a=t[o]={exports:{}};return e[o](a,a.exports,n),a.exports}n.n=e=>{var t=e&&e.__esModule?()=>e.default:()=>e;return n.d(t,{a:t}),t},n.d=(e,t)=>{for(var o in t)n.o(t,o)&&!n.o(e,o)&&Object.defineProperty(e,o,{enumerable:!0,get:t[o]})},n.o=(e,t)=>Object.prototype.hasOwnProperty.call(e,t),n.r=e=>{“undefined”!=typeof Symbol&&Symbol.toStringTag&&Object.defineProperty(e,Symbol.toStringTag,{value:”Module”}),Object.defineProperty(e,”__esModule”,{value:!0})};var o={};(()=>{n.d(o,{default:()=>e});const e={hydrate:function(e,t){var o=n(651),r=n(745),a=n(973).default;r.hydrateRoot(t,o.createElement(a,e))}}})(),newsletterForm=o.default})(); //# sourceMappingURL=newsletterForm.js.map window.sliceComponents.newsletterForm = newsletterForm; var triggerHydrate = function() { window.sliceComponents.newsletterForm.hydrate(data, componentContainer); } if (window.lazyObserveElement) { window.lazyObserveElement(componentContainer, triggerHydrate); } else { triggerHydrate(); } } }).catch(err => console.error(‘%c FTE ‘,’background: #9306F9; color: #ffffff’,’Hydration Script has failed for newsletterForm-articleInbodyContent-E4KD9ne4DPbz7Nn3f9n6FT Slice’, err)); }).catch(err => console.error(‘%c FTE ‘,’background: #9306F9; color: #ffffff’,’Externals script failed to load’, err)); ]]>

Get exclusive access to fashion and beauty trends, hot-off-the-press celebrity news, and more.

You May Also Like

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다